Saber Renewable Energy achieves FuturePlus Impact Certification

Independent certification validates Saber’s commitment to positive social and environmental outcomes across UK renewable energy deployment programmes.

London, UK

Saber Renewable Energy has achieved FuturePlus Impact Certification, recognising the group’s commitment to delivering positive outcomes across environmental, social, and governance dimensions of its renewable energy deployments.

The certification is the result of an independent assessment of the group’s impact methodology, deployment governance, and the verifiable outcomes delivered to client sites and the communities around them.

Saber’s deployment model focuses on long-term Power Purchase Agreements that fund renewable infrastructure with no upfront capital outlay from the client, alongside operational governance that publishes metered generation data through the Saber Intelligence Platform.

Independent certification matters because our clients use our deployment data in their own ESG reporting. They need to know that the underlying methodology stands up to external scrutiny.

David Wills

Founder and Group CEO, Saber Renewable Energy
